Smart Parking Scheme

The Fair Care Smart Parking Scheme works within current tax legislation, enabling employees to save up to 50% of their parking costs. Operated via salary sacrifice, there are savings for the employer too. Fair Care has developed a simple, fully-outsourced solution for employers wishing to implement this valuable benefit.

Employers are able to provide car parking spaces for their employees, at or near to the workplace, without the employee paying any income tax or National Insurance on the cost of that space. The Scheme operates via salary sacrifice, which means the parking costs are first met by the employer but then recovered from the employee by way of deductions from their gross pay. This gives rise to income tax and National Insurance savings for the employee, as well as National Insurance savings for the employer.

The scheme lends itself perfectly to situations where employees are purchasing season tickets or permits. The scheme can also be used to good effect where employees currently make a contribution to their employer for use of a space.
